Inter have taken
the habit of drawing games another step further with a 2-2
tie against Juve. The draw should not be news worthy any more
as Inter have tied 11 matches thus far. However coming back
from a 2 goal deficit for the second straight week is more
exciting. But coming back against Juve, well that makes it
headline news.
Inter fell behind
2-0 with goals by Zalayeta and Ibrahimovic but Mancini invents
a 4-2-4 formation with Recoba, Adriano, Vieri and Martins
all on the pitch to help gain the draw with Vieri and Adriano
scoring for Inter and earning the point. Inter are still 15
points behind Juve and that however is the most important
fact of the day.
Mancini insists
on going with Mihajlovic in the center of defence and also
starts with Van Der Meyde and Davids as wingers in a 4-4-2
formation with Cambiasso and Stankovic central with a striker
partnership of Adriano and Martins.
The first 15 minutes
of the match were not exciting as both teams seemed to be
in study mode, but Inter did seem to have more control of
the ball but could not create any clear cut chances. The final
pass of Veron would have been an asset today as Stankovic
playing in the center could not feed the strikers. Inter had
very little play on the wings and so it was up to Adriano
and Martins to find a solution which never arrived.
Juventus who were
in a gear below held there back line well and really did not
give up chances to the Inter forwards. When in possession
they moved the ball well as is expected from a team that has
played together for a long time. Camoranesi and Nedved added
spark attacking and swapped well with defensive players like
Zambrotta on the wing to create space.
But Inter do well
to control and seemed to have the marking right. If Nedved
would cut inside, Zanetti would follow and either Van Der
Meyde or Stankovic would stay wide on Zambrotta. Cordoba and
Mihajlovic stuck tight on Zalayeta and Ibrahimovic making
the half a pretty bland and blocked affair.
Only two goal scoring
chances were seen all half as Davids cleared a Nedved header
from a corner kick off the line and Zebina just did enough
to stop Adriano from scoring on a great through ball by Stankovic
which unfortunately was his only one of the match. The first
half ends 0-0 and all to play for in the second.
The second half
starts with Inter making a change and bringing on Ze Maria
for injured Favalli. J. Zanetti takes his spot on the left
with the Brazilian playing on the right. It was a change that
needed to happen because of injury but it did have an impact
on Inter who had some good balance in the first half.
It took only a
few minutes into the second for Inter to go down 1-0 and were
unlucky to do so. Nedved takes a long range shot from outside
that Toldo looks to have covered but the ball takes a deflection
off of Zalayeta's knee to beat Toldo to the left as he was
already moving to the right.
Its the tale of
Inter's season thus far. Either a bad defensive mistake, or
an unlucky deflection like tonight see the team punished despite
playing well. Stankovic had a classic expression after the
goal looking up to the stars and shrugging as if to say hey,
here we go again...what more can we do?
Inter have a tough
time digesting the unlucky goal and Juve begin to take control
of the match as they move the ball around well and send many
crosses into the area for the tall strikers of Ibrahimovic
and Zalayeta. If the first goal was an unlucky break, the
second goal was defensive amnesia on Inter's part as Ibrahimovic
draws a defender wide and then passes to Camoranesi. Mijaholivic
takes the bait and moves towards the side but leaves Zalayeta
all alone as Camoranesi passes and sets him free.
Toldo could do
nothing but rush out and make a challenge. The ball goes past
him, and Zalayeta falls giving Juve the Penalty Shot. To be
fair Toldo should have been red carded as he was clearly the
last man but was saved by the ref and took only a yellow.
Ibrahimovic converts and the game looks to sealed as they
lead 2-0 at the 21st minute.
Mancini decides
to go for it all and turns his formation from a 4-4-2 to a
4-2-4 bringing on Vieri and Recoba for Davids and Van Der
Meyde and lining up with Recoba wide on the left, Vieri and
Adriano central with Martins wide on the right.
Vieri puts life
back into the match as he takes a great ball into the area
and puts a wonderful diagonal shot past buffon to make it
2-1. The comeback is made complete with only 5 minutes left
as Vieri then feeds Martins wide on the right side. Adriano
starts his run into the center and Martins sends an inch perfect
pass behind the defence for Adriano to volley a wonderful
goal past Buffon to make it 2-2.
The final assault
does not lead to a third goal and once again Inter must settle
for a draw instead of the win. Overall they played well but
an unlucky bounce and a huge defensive mistake cost Inter
the 3 points. The team has so much potential going forward
and has displayed some wonderful football but can't seem to
find the key to victory.
Given that this
draw came against Juve and also involved a wonderful comeback
with two great goals, Inter leave the pitch among applause
and ovation. In reality though, the only team that should
be smiling after this game is Milan who know find themselves
only 4 points back of Juventus for the title race.
